Discover the Vibrant Pulse of Makati: A Tapestry of Culture and Modernity

Nestled in the heart of the Philippines, Makati is a bustling metropolis that embodies the pulse of modern urban life. Renowned for its striking skyline and vibrant business district, Makati offers a delightful blend of luxury shopping along Makati Avenue and cultural experiences at the Makati Museum. Visitors can unwind in the lush Makati Park, a serene oasis amidst the city’s hustle. With its eclectic dining options, lively nightlife, and artistic flair, Makati is a captivating destination for both the cosmopolitan traveller and the curious adventurer seeking to explore the dynamic spirit of the National Capital Region.

Top locations to stay in Makati

In Pasay, Taguig, and Mandaluyong, each area offers unique attractions for visitors. Pasay is ideal for shopping and nightlife, while Taguig boasts vibrant dining options and scenic parks. Mandaluyong features a blend of shopping and urban life. For first-time visitors, Taguig is best suited due to its lively atmosphere and variety of experiences.

  1. PasayOpens in a new window: Pasay is a vibrant area known for its shopping and entertainment options, making it an ideal base for your adventures in the Philippines. Visitors can explore large shopping malls like SM Mall of Asia, one of the biggest in the country, offering a wide variety of shops, dining options, and exciting activities. The area is also close to cultural attractions such as the Cultural Center of the Philippines, where you can catch performances and exhibitions showcasing local talent. With its proximity to the airport, Pasay is convenient for travelers looking to maximise their time in the city.
  2. TaguigOpens in a new window: Taguig is a trendy district that boasts a fantastic blend of modern shopping and dining experiences. The upscale Bonifacio Global City (BGC) is a major highlight, featuring a range of international shops, art installations, and parks that provide a lively atmosphere. Enjoy leisurely strolls while discovering the vibrant street art or unwind in one of the many cafes. Taguig also comes alive with cultural activities, making it a great spot for those who appreciate a mix of urban excitement and local charm.
  3. MandaluyongOpens in a new window: Mandaluyong is an emerging destination for shopping enthusiasts, with a variety of malls and boutique stores. The area is home to Shangri-La Plaza, a stylish shopping centre that offers everything from high-end brands to local fashion. You can also explore the local markets for unique souvenirs and goods. Although smaller than its neighbouring districts, Mandaluyong has a friendly vibe and is well-connected, making it easy to venture out to nearby attractions and enjoy the lively city atmosphere.

Best time to go to Makati

Makati exper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 78.1°F (25.6°C), while May is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 85.3°F (29.6°C). July is usually the wettest month. April, July, and September are the peak travel months in Makati,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ny to mostly cloudy, accompanied by no to frequent rainfall. On the other hand, August, October, and December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light to frequent r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
